NEXT MEETING___________________________
Monday, Feb. 2, 2009 - Noon –
“How Obama
broke new ground in making use of the internet” - Adrianne Royer, Director of
Communications and Development of Girls, Inc. will speak about Obama’s use
of the internet in the recent presidential campaign. She will describe how powerful the internet can be for future
campaigning. Many of President Obama’s new ideas will soon be a standard
procedure in politics and business.
